The Sea

Two years after her husband's unfortunate death and four years after the release of her multi-platinum debut album, Corinne Bailey Rae has returned to the music scene with "The Sea". Many artists struggle with their second album especially if the first is a solid piece. However this is not the case with "The Sea", the album is stellar.

Classic Sade

Not since the 2000 release of Lovers Rock has the soulful group Sade released a studio album. The super group composed of one of the most talented vocalists and team of wonderful musicians has come back stronger than ever with Solider of Love, during a time where senseless lyrics and studio beats are ruling the airwaves .

Carey's Memoirs Slightly Imperfect

The twelfth studio album from Mariah Carey, Memoirs of an Imperfect Angel is jammed packed with seventeen tracks featuring only Mariah Carey. The album has one or two tracks that are up-tempo, other than that, the album is full of love songs that cross the many phases of love.

Like Whitney Never Left

Since 2002 we have not heard one of the greatest voices in our lifetime. When Whitney Houston's first single "I Look to You" was released, it was a little disappointing, not her best work. One hoped that it was not an indication of what was on the album.

The Best Hip-Hop album for 2009

It's a little early to announce this considering we have a few months left in the year, however there isn't a second thought that anyone will be releasing an album that is as good a Ghostface Killah's ninth studio album, Ghostdini-The Wizard of Poetry
